This was a cake I made for my Assistant Manager, Joe and I's birthdays. Our birthdays are just a few days apart and at this time I was fairly new to the job, so I wanted to do something nice for the staff that was so welcoming to me when I started as well as help celebrate our birthdays.
The design comes from my artistic background. I wanted a cake that looked both painterly and sketchy. The roses and flowers are very similar to designs you would find on my ceramic artwork and in my paintings. I love watercolor cakes and watching the colors blend, but I also wanted for this cake to have that choppy rough paint look. The sprinkles act as an aid to help complete my vision for this cake!
Now recipe time.
I got the recipe for the cake from Mandy Merriman's cookbook, "Cake Confidence" which is a PERFECT book for beginner bakers as well as bakers who want to explore different flavor combinations! The frosting on the inside of the cake is the blueberry buttercream that she paired with her lemon poppy seed cake and the outside is her traditional white buttercream that I dyed a few different colors!
